Union Bank of India, Bank of Baroda Cut Lending Rates
On Friday, the Union Bank of India announced a cut in its marginal cost of funds based lending rate (MCLR) by 0.10 percent across tenures. The change will be effective from Saturday.

The public sector lender said this is the seventh consecutive rate cut announced by the lender since July 2019. Its cumulative rate cut is in the range of 60-75 basis points (0.60-0.75 percent) across different tenures since February 2019.
Union Bank of India lending rates with effect from 11 January 2020:
| Tenure | MCLR (%) |
|---|---|
| Overnight MCLR | 7.65% |
| 1 month MCLR | 7.70% |
| 3 month MCLR | 7.85% |
| 6 month MCLR | 7.95% |
| 1 year MCLR | 8.10% |
| 2 year MCLR | 8.25% |
| 3 year MCLR | 8.30% |
Similarly, Bank of Baroda in a stock exchange filing on Friday informed a reduction in its MCLR for the one-month tenure. The change will be effective from Sunday. Rates on all other tenures will remain unchanged.
Bank of Baroda lending rates with effect from 12 January 2020:
| Tenure | MCLR (%) |
|---|---|
| Overnight MCLR | 7.65% |
| 1 month MCLR | 7.60% |
| 3 month MCLR | 7.80% |
| 6 month MCLR | 8.10% |
| 1 year MCLR | 8.25% |
